AI Contract Overview
The contract requires management of subcontractor compliance with critical defense regulation flow-down clauses, specifically enforcing prohibitions on hexavalent chromium usage, adherence to restrictions on Chinese telecommunications equipment, and strict implementation of export control regulations. All subcontractors must be monitored and verified to ensure alignment with these mandatory requirements as dictated by the Defense Federal Acquisition Regulation Supplement, with ongoing oversight to prevent noncompliance across the supply chain. The performance location is set in Tracy, California, with the contracting activity under the Department of Defense’s Maritime Supply Chain organization. The solicitation is for a subcontracting engagement categorized under NAICS code 541611, indicating it involves management consulting services related to regulatory alignment. Responses are due by August 13, 2026, with the posting date occurring on August 2, 2026, leaving a narrow window for qualified contractors to submit proposals. The contract does not specify a set-aside designation, making it open to full and open competition without socioeconomic restrictions.
